I just got a reply back from CBID on this issue. They are not willing to change their shipping policy to better serve their customers. In the interest of higher profits for them and lower quality service for us, they will only ship via UPS Smart Post which is cheaper for them but actually adds a day in transit, as UPS must deliver to the post office and then they get delivered the next day by USPS. I was accustomed to paying the extra for USPS service, and didn't mind doing so. Now, they give me no choice on shipping. It's sad that a company which sells premium luxury products would have such callous disregard for it's clients.

Good morning dstieger,Thank you for choosing CigarBid.com. The Saver shipping is a more economical shipping option which allows us to keep offering the variety of products you are used to ordering on our site without raising the shipping rates for additional units. The Saver shipping uses the USPS, UPS, or a combination of both and will deliver in no more than 6 business days. We’re sorry, but we are not in a position to change this shipping service. If you have any additional questions, please let me know. Thank you, DamarieCustomer Service
